Panbecha - Sibsagar, Sivasagar
Panbecha is a village situated in the Sibsagar subdivision of Sivasagar district, Assam. It is located approximately 8 km from the tehsil headquarters in Sibsagar and around 8 km from the district headquarters in Sivasagar. Panbecha village is a designated Gram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Panbecha is 292663. The village covers a total geographical area of 269.09 hectares and falls under the 785663 pincode. Sibsagar is the nearest town, located about 8 km away.
Panbecha village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Sivasagar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Jorhat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Panbecha
As per Census 2011, Panbecha village has a total population of 1,245 people, consisting of 632 males and 613 females. The village has 246 households and a sex ratio of 969 females per 1,000 males. There are 136 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 1,042 literate and 203 illiterate residents.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Panbecha are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 1,245 | 632 | 613 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 136 | 73 | 63 |
| Literate Population | 1,042 | 541 | 501 |
| Illiterate Population | 203 | 91 | 112 |

Transport and Connectivity of Panbecha
Panbecha is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is located within 5-10 km of Panbecha.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Private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Railway Station | No | Available within 5-10 km |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Sibsagar to Panbecha is about 8 km, with a usual travel time of around 15-30 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Sivasagar to Panbecha is about 8 km, with the usual travel time around 15-30 minutes.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
